Ingredients List
- 1 cup all-purpose flour
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 cup unsalted butter, melted
- 1/4 cup grated parmesan cheese
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 2 tablespoons fresh parsley, chopped
- 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
How to Prepare Instructions
Prepare the Dough
Let’s get started on these delicious knots! In a medium-sized bowl, combine 1 cup of all-purpose flour, 1 teaspoon of baking powder, and 1/4 teaspoon of salt. Give it a quick whisk to combine the dry ingredients well. In another bowl, melt 1/4 cup of unsalted butter and let it cool slightly. Then mix in 1/4 cup of grated parmesan cheese, 2 cloves of minced garlic, 2 tablespoons of chopped fresh parsley, 1/2 teaspoon of garlic powder, and 1/4 teaspoon of black pepper. Stir until everything is well combined. Now, gently fold the wet mixture into the dry ingredients. Be careful not to over-knead; just work it until a soft dough forms. If it feels too sticky, sprinkle in a little more flour! It should be smooth and slightly tacky.
Shape the Knots
Now comes the fun part—shaping these little beauties! Lightly flour your work surface and turn the dough out onto it. Divide the dough into 12 equal pieces. Roll each piece into a rope about 6 inches long. To shape your knots, take the rope, make a loose loop, and then tuck one end underneath the loop and pull it through. This creates a lovely knot shape. Don’t stress if they don’t look perfect—each knot has its own personality! Just make sure they’re not too tight; you want them to have some room to puff up in the air fryer.
Air Frying Process
Preheat your air fryer to 350°F (175°C). Once it’s ready, carefully arrange the knots in the air fryer basket, making sure they’re not touching each other. This helps them cook evenly and get that perfect golden brown color. Cook them for about 8 to 10 minutes. You’ll know they’re done when they’re golden and your kitchen smells like garlic heaven. If you like them extra crispy, you can let them go for an additional minute or two, but keep an eye on them! Once they’re out, brush them with a little more melted butter and sprinkle on some extra parmesan while they’re still warm. Yum!

Tips for Success
To ensure your air fryer garlic parmesan knots turn out perfectly, here are some expert tips that I’ve gathered over the years. First, if you want to up the flavor, consider swapping out the parmesan for a mix of cheeses like mozzarella or asiago for a different twist. You can also add a pinch of red pepper flakes to the garlic mixture if you’re in the mood for a bit of heat!
When it comes to kneading the dough, remember to be gentle. Overworking the dough can lead to tough knots, and we definitely don’t want that! If you find your dough too sticky, add a little more flour, but go easy; you want it soft and pliable. For an extra boost of flavor, brush the knots with garlic butter right after they come out of the air fryer, and don’t skimp on the parsley—it really brightens up the dish!
Lastly, if you have leftovers (which is rare, let’s be honest), store them in an airtight container at room temperature for a day or two. They taste best fresh, but you can always reheat them in the air fryer for a few minutes to bring back that delightful crispiness. Happy cooking!

FAQ Section
Can I use whole wheat flour instead of all-purpose flour?
Absolutely! Whole wheat flour will give your air fryer garlic parmesan knots a nuttier flavor and a bit more texture. Just keep in mind that they might be slightly denser, so you may need to adjust the liquid in the recipe a tad.
What if I don’t have fresh parsley?
No worries! If you’re out of fresh parsley, dried parsley works just fine. You can also experiment with other herbs like basil or chives for a different flavor. Just remember to use less dried herbs since they’re more concentrated!
How do I store leftovers?
If you have any leftover knots (which is rare, I know!), store them in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 2 days. For longer storage, you can pop them in the fridge, but they’re best enjoyed fresh. Reheat them in the air fryer for a few minutes to bring back that yummy crispiness!
Can I make these knots ahead of time?
Yes! You can prepare the dough, shape the knots, and refrigerate them for a few hours before air frying. Just let them sit at room temperature for about 10-15 minutes before cooking to ensure even baking.
Why aren’t my knots getting golden brown?
If your knots aren’t browning, it could be due to overcrowding in the air fryer basket. Make sure they have enough space to cook evenly. Also, a little extra brush of melted butter before air frying can help achieve that golden color!
